What does it mean to dream of a large black dog for a woman that bites? - briefly
Dreaming of a large black dog that bites can be a powerful and unsettling experience for a woman. This dream often symbolizes repressed emotions or fears that need to be acknowledged and addressed. Black dogs in dreams frequently represent the unknown or hidden aspects of the psyche. The biting action may indicate feelings of aggression, anxiety, or a sense of being overwhelmed. It could also suggest that the dreamer is feeling threatened or attacked in some area of her life. Additionally, the size of the dog might emphasize the magnitude of these emotions or issues.
To interpret this dream, consider the following points:
- Emotional State: Reflect on current emotional states or recent events that might be causing stress or anxiety.
- Personal Associations: Think about any personal associations with black dogs or biting, as these can provide deeper insight into the dream's meaning.
- Life Situations: Evaluate any situations in life where the dreamer might feel threatened or out of control.
A large black dog that bites in a dream for a woman typically signifies repressed fears or emotions that require attention. Addressing these underlying issues can lead to greater emotional clarity and resolution.
What does it mean to dream of a large black dog for a woman that bites? - in detail
Dreaming of a large black dog that bites can be a vivid and unsettling experience for a woman. To understand the significance of such a dream, it is essential to delve into the symbolism associated with each element: the color black, the size of the dog, and the act of biting.
The color black in dreams often symbolizes the unknown, the mysterious, or the hidden aspects of the psyche. It can represent fears, anxieties, or repressed emotions that the dreamer may be avoiding in her waking life. Black is also associated with power and strength, suggesting that the dreamer might be grappling with powerful emotions or situations that she feels are beyond her control.
The size of the dog is another crucial factor. A large dog typically signifies a significant presence or influence in the dreamer's life. It could indicate that the dreamer is feeling overwhelmed by a particular situation or person. The size of the dog might also reflect the intensity of the emotions the dreamer is experiencing, suggesting that these feelings are substantial and cannot be easily ignored.
The act of biting is a clear indication of aggression or threat. In the realm of dreams, biting can symbolize feelings of being attacked, harmed, or betrayed. It might also represent the dreamer's own aggressive tendencies or repressed anger that is surfacing. The bite from a large black dog could signify that the dreamer is feeling threatened by a powerful force in her life, or it could indicate that she is struggling with her own inner conflicts and fears.
To interpret this dream more accurately, consider the following factors:
- Emotional State: Reflect on the dreamer's current emotional state. Is she feeling anxious, fearful, or angry? These emotions could be manifesting in the dream as a large black dog that bites.
- Recent Events: Consider any recent events or situations that might have triggered these feelings. Has the dreamer experienced a betrayal, a loss, or a significant challenge?
- Personal Associations: Think about the dreamer's personal associations with black dogs. Does she have any past experiences or cultural beliefs that might influence her interpretation of the dream?
- Symbolic Meaning: Explore the symbolic meaning of dogs in general. Dogs often represent loyalty, protection, and companionship, but they can also symbolize wild, untamed aspects of the self.
In summary, dreaming of a large black dog that bites can be a powerful and revealing experience. It may indicate that the dreamer is dealing with deep-seated fears, repressed emotions, or significant challenges in her waking life. By examining the symbolism of the color black, the size of the dog, and the act of biting, the dreamer can gain valuable insights into her inner world and the issues she needs to address.
